Conil De La Frontera
Overview
Conil de la Frontera is situated on the Costa de la Luz in the province Cadiz (Spain) in Andalusia; this village on the seaside is quite picturesque. You will find that this village is typically Spanish with white walls and streets. The distance from Cadiz to this place is about 25 miles. The population in this village is about 18000.
This town is hardly 12 KM from the Spanish hilltop town - Vejer de la Frontera and is a popular tourist resort. Once upon a time this was a poor fishing village; however nowadays it is quite modern although some old buildings still remain. In mid-season the nightlife in this place is quite lively.
History
The origin of the town Conil de la Frontera dates back to the Phoenicians who were looking for exploiting a new way of tuna fishing. Many tribes and nationalities - Carthaginians, Visigoths, Moslems, Romans, Byzantines, Vandals and Christians have ruled Conil sometime or other..
Climate
The maximum and minimum average temperatures in this city are 26 °C in August and 12 °C in January. This village gets 3200 hours of sunshine in a year.

Cuisine
The coastline of this town is about 16 KM and there are more than 350 bars, cafes and restaurants in this place. Seafood is highly popular in this place and the most popular is the ortiguillas that is deep-fried sea anemones.
Sports and Entertainment
Sports activities that are popular in Conil are sailing, horse riding, fishing, cycling, trekking. In addition there are other sports activities such as surfing, scuba diving and wind and kite surfing.
The small town Tarifa is near Conil and you can sail in the sea with the scientists either to discover new species in the Gibraltar strait or to see the whales.
The seawater along the Costa de la Luz coastline is crystal clear and there is fine white sand for a distance of 14 KM. The clean blue waters are ideal for snorkeling and swimming.
There are a number of beautiful beaches in this area and popular among them are - La Fontanilla, Los Bateles, El Roqueo, Castilnovo, Roche, etc.
The nightlife attraction - Las Carpas or the tents takes place in the summer. This is a large entertainment complex on the beach wherein entertainments such as salsa, dance bands, flamenco shows, etc. are hosted for all ages and these are done free of cost.
